编程模块安装位置要求是什么
-
编程模块的安装位置是指在计算机系统中放置程序代码文件的位置。根据不同的编程语言和操作系统,对于编程模块的安装位置有一些基本的要求。
-
编程语言要求:不同的编程语言对于模块的安装位置可能会有一些差异。例如,Python中的模块通常被安装在标准库或第三方库的位置,而Java中的模块则通常被安装在类路径下。
-
操作系统要求:不同的操作系统也会对于编程模块的安装位置有一些要求。例如,Windows系统通常会将编程模块安装在系统的环境变量中指定的路径下,而Linux系统则通常会将模块安装在特定的目录下,如/usr/lib或/usr/local/lib。
-
环境变量要求:编程模块的安装位置通常需要添加到系统的环境变量中,以便程序可以找到并调用这些模块。环境变量是操作系统中一种存储常用信息的机制,通过在环境变量中添加模块的安装位置,程序就可以在任何位置调用这些模块。
-
模块管理工具要求:在某些编程语言中,使用模块管理工具可以更方便地安装和管理编程模块。例如,Python中的pip工具可以帮助用户从Python Package Index(PyPI)上安装和管理模块。
总的来说,编程模块的安装位置要求主要包括编程语言要求、操作系统要求、环境变量要求和模块管理工具要求。根据具体的编程环境和需求,我们需要了解并满足相应的要求,以确保编程模块能够正确地被安装和调用。
1年前 -
-
编程模块安装位置是指在计算机中安装编程模块的目录或路径。安装位置的要求可以根据不同的编程语言、操作系统和开发工具而有所不同。以下是一些常见的编程模块安装位置要求:
-
系统级安装位置:有些编程模块需要在操作系统的系统级目录中进行安装,以便在整个系统范围内可用。这些位置可能包括操作系统的库目录或系统目录。在Windows操作系统中,这些位置通常是
C:\Windows\System32或C:\Windows\SysWOW64;在Linux操作系统中,这些位置通常是/usr/lib或/usr/local/lib。 -
用户级安装位置:有些编程模块可以在用户的个人目录中进行安装,只对该用户可用。这些位置通常是用户的主目录下的一个子目录,例如
~/bin或~/lib。用户级安装位置的好处是,用户可以在不影响系统的情况下安装和管理自己需要的模块。 -
开发工具安装位置:许多编程语言和开发工具提供了自己的模块安装位置。例如,Python的模块可以通过pip工具安装到Python的site-packages目录中;Java的模块可以通过Maven或Gradle等构建工具管理,这些工具会将模块下载并安装到特定的目录中。
-
特定应用程序安装位置:某些编程模块需要安装到特定的应用程序目录中才能被该应用程序使用。这些位置通常由应用程序的开发者指定,并在应用程序的文档中进行说明。例如,WordPress插件需要安装到WordPress的插件目录中才能被WordPress加载和使用。
-
环境变量设置:安装编程模块后,通常需要将其所在的安装位置添加到系统的环境变量中,以便编程语言或开发工具能够找到并使用这些模块。具体的环境变量设置方式取决于操作系统和编程语言。在Windows操作系统中,可以通过在系统属性中设置环境变量;在Linux操作系统中,可以通过修改
~/.bashrc或~/.bash_profile文件来设置环境变量。
总之,编程模块的安装位置要求是根据具体的编程语言、操作系统和开发工具而有所不同。了解和遵守这些要求可以确保编程模块能够正确安装和使用。
1年前 -
-
编程模块安装位置要求是指在编程环境中,将模块文件放置的特定位置。不同的编程语言和开发工具可能有不同的安装位置要求,下面是一些常见的安装位置要求示例:
-
Python:Python是一种广泛使用的编程语言,其模块安装位置要求如下:
- 系统级模块:系统级模块应该安装在Python解释器的site-packages目录下。在Windows系统上,通常是
C:\PythonXX\Lib\site-packages;在Linux或MacOS系统上,通常是/usr/lib/pythonXX/site-packages。 - 用户级模块:用户级模块应该安装在用户的个人目录下,例如
~/.local/lib/pythonXX/site-packages。
- 系统级模块:系统级模块应该安装在Python解释器的site-packages目录下。在Windows系统上,通常是
-
Java:Java是一种面向对象的编程语言,其模块安装位置要求如下:
- Java库:Java库通常是以JAR文件的形式提供的,可以将JAR文件放置在项目的classpath中,或者放置在Java虚拟机的扩展目录中。
- Java模块:从Java 9开始,Java引入了模块化系统,模块应该被放置在模块路径中,可以通过命令行参数
--module-path指定模块路径。
-
JavaScript:JavaScript是一种常用的脚本语言,其模块安装位置要求如下:
- Node.js模块:Node.js使用npm(Node Package Manager)来管理模块,通过npm安装的模块会被放置在项目的
node_modules目录下。 - 浏览器模块:在浏览器环境中,可以使用ES6的模块语法来导入和导出模块。浏览器模块可以通过
<script type="module" src="module.js"></script>的方式引入。
- Node.js模块:Node.js使用npm(Node Package Manager)来管理模块,通过npm安装的模块会被放置在项目的
-
C/C++:C和C++是一种常用的系统级编程语言,其模块安装位置要求如下:
- 头文件:C和C++的头文件通常被放置在系统的include目录下,例如
/usr/include。 - 静态库:静态库通常被放置在系统的lib目录下,例如
/usr/lib。 - 动态库:动态库通常被放置在系统的lib目录下,或者被放置在特定的库路径中,例如
/usr/lib或/usr/local/lib。
- 头文件:C和C++的头文件通常被放置在系统的include目录下,例如
总之,不同的编程语言和开发工具有不同的模块安装位置要求,开发者应该根据具体情况来正确安装模块。
1年前 -